Counting skills are fundamental for young children aged 4-8 because they form the building blocks for all future mathematical learning. Parents and teachers should care deeply about these skills because they not only guide children in understanding numbers and quantities, but also enhance cognitive development and problem-solving abilities. For a child, counting isn't just about memorizing sequences; it involves understanding one-to-one correspondence, the ability to recognize numbers in various forms, and the skill to connect counting with real-world objects.
When counting becomes easy and intuitive for children, it bolsters their confidence and encourages a positive attitude towards learning. This foundation supports their education in other critical subjects like addition, subtraction, and eventually more complex mathematical concepts. In addition, early counting skills are directly linked to better performance in school, which can influence a child's long-term academic success.
Engaging children in counting activities makes math fun and interactive. Games, songs, and playful counting exercises foster a joyful learning environment and strengthen the bond between parent and child or teacher and student. Thus, prioritizing counting skills for ages 4-8 is essential not only for immediate educational benefits but also for fostering a lifelong love of learning and problem-solving.
